If you live in a cold climate in the Northern Hemisphere, you can take advantage of the sun by having more windows facing south. Orientation is important for sustainable homes. Orientation Of Your House For Natural Light And Heat Smaller houses are inherently more efficient and less wasteful. Think about your needs and try not to go overboard with the size of your house. A larger house will obviously use more materials and require more energy for heating and cooling. Building a smaller house is going to reduce your material use and energy needs. Not everyone interested in sustainable house design is going to go down this route, but smaller houses are far more efficient. Building sustainable homes not only saves you money in the long run, but also reduces your impact on the environment. In this article we will outline 21 tips for a sustainable house design. Building with sustainability in mind should be standard for a twenty first century home. What we build matters, and so does how we build it. This means energy efficiency, avoiding environmental toxins, and using materials and resources in a responsible manner while having a positive physical and psychological impact on its inhabitants. A sustainable house is a home that has the least possible negative impact on our environment.
